Mazda CX-5 vs.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ross
iSeeCars' unbiased and data-driven comparison of the Mazda CX-5 and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ross contrasts the two cars across a broad spectrum of vehicle specifications to determine which car is better. In addition to comparing pricing and specs, iSeeCars uses all the ratings, rankings, and insights from its comprehensive analyses of each vehicle model, including calculations of reliability, safety, depreciation, value retention, and the vehicle's projected lifetime recalls (based on analyzing over 25 billion data points). This in-depth evaluation is used to identify which vehicle represents a better overall choice for shoppers who are considering both the Mazda CX-5 and the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ross.
When we compare the Mazda CX-5's and the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ross's specifications and ratings, the Mazda CX-5 has the advantage in the areas of resale value, interior volume and base engine power. The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ross has the advantage in the areas of new vehicle base pricing and typical lower range of pricing for one- to five-year-old used cars. Based on this comparison of the Mazda CX-5's and the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ross's specifications and ratings, the Mazda CX-5 is a better car than the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ross.
Pricing: A used 2025 Mazda CX-5 ranges from $25,750 to $37,887 while a used 2025 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ross is priced between $22,636 to $33,091. For a new model, the Mazda CX-5's price is between $31,061 and $41,347, with the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ross priced between $26,479 and $34,378.
Resale/Retained Value: Looking at the 5-year depreciation rate for both models, the Mazda CX-5 loses 42.4 percent of its value and the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ross loses 50 percent of its value. This means the Mazda CX-5 retains 7.6 percentage points more of its value and has the advantage of higher resale value versus the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ross.
Engine Power and Fuel Efficiency Comparison: For engine performance, the Mazda CX-5’s base engine makes 187 horsepower, and the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ross base engine makes 152 horsepower.
Passenger Space Comparison: While both models are crossover/compact SUVs, the Mazda CX-5 has the advantage of offering more interior volume, reflected in more front head room, front shoulder room, front leg room, rear head room, rear leg room, and cargo space. The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ross has the advantage in the area of rear shoulder room.
Safety Ratings: When comparing crash test ratings from NHTSA, both the Mazda CX-5 and the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ross have the same average safety rating of 5 out of 5 Stars.

The Mazda CX-5 is a compact crossover with seating for five and a reputation as a favorite for drivers. The current Mazda CX-5 was redesigned for the 2017 model year, with new models costing an average of $32,211 and recent models averaging $23,771.
Summary Review
The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ross is an affordable subcompact crossover ideal for families on a budget. It was introduced as an all-new vehicle for the 2018 model year, with new models costing an average of $27,997 and 3-year-old models averaging $19,605.
